Del curso: SQL Server para programación avanzado

Accede al curso completo hoy mismo

Únete hoy para acceder a más de 25.000 cursos impartidos por expertos del sector.

Triggers en SQL Server

Triggers en SQL Server

Los trigger no son recomendados durante el procesamiento normal en una base de datos, dado que realizan operaciones fila a fila y no basadas en conjunto. Sin embargo, en algunos casos especiales, es necesario implementarlos y para alguna lógica en particular se requieren utilizando .NET. Para eso, vamos a crear un proyecto y vamos a analizar las opciones que tenemos al generar un proyecto C# para crear triggers. Vamos a establecer este nombre, y ahora vamos a agregar un nuevo ítem desencadenado, y vamos a crearlo con este nombre. Inicialmente Visual Studio nos muestra esta plantilla con la cual podemos crear nuestro desencadenador, pero vamos a crear nuestro propio código de manera que podamos analizarlo. En este caso, estamos utilizando System.Transactions y para poderlo aplicar vamos a agregar una referencia a ese espacio de nombres para poderlo utilizar. Muy bien. Ahora iniciamos la implementación de la función principal de nuestro trigger…

Contenido